GS8B032210DCT Description
GS8B032210DCT Description
The GS8B032210DCT from TT Electronics/IRC is a high-precision ceramic resistor network designed for demanding surface-mount applications. Housed in a 16-pin narrow SOIC package, it features 15 bussed resistors with a 221Ω resistance value and an absolute tolerance of ±0.5%, ensuring consistent performance in precision circuits. The thin-film technology delivers a low temperature coefficient of ±25ppm/°C, making it stable across a wide operating temperature range of -55°C to +125°C. With a power rating of 0.8W (0.05W per resistor) and a maximum voltage rating of 100V, this network is engineered for reliability in compact designs.
GS8B032210DCT Features
- High Precision: ±0.5% absolute tolerance and ±0.25% ratio tolerance for critical analog/digital applications.
- Robust Construction: Ceramic case ensures durability and thermal stability.
- Space-Efficient: Compact SOIC package (9.91mm × 5.99mm × 1.45mm) with 1.27mm terminal pitch for high-density PCB layouts.
- Wide Temperature Range: Operates from -55°C to +125°C with derated power up to 125°C.
- Low TCR: ±25ppm/°C minimizes resistance drift under thermal stress.
